EJBCA can run on a supported application server (currently JEE10). Due to differences between application servers, your application server should be configured according to the application server specific instructions referenced below.
The following lists supported application servers.
While EJBCA could theoretically run on any JEE10 capable application server, the vast majority of our user base uses JBoss/WildFly, so focus has been given to documenting those implementations.
Application Server
WildFly 32
Requires EJBCA 9
JBoss EAP 8.0
Requires EJBCA 9
Next Step: Pick your Application Server
Depending on your application server, select configuration instructions below: